详解zscore模型

一、 zscore模型怎么分析

zscore,中文名标准分数,是一种统计方法,用于帮助我们快速分析和比较数据,特别是在数据分布不均的情况下。

通过zscore分析,我们可以得出一个数据点所处于整个数据集中的相对位置。zscore值大于0,则表示该数据点高于平均水平;小于0则表示低于平均水平。

因此,zscore可以帮助我们进行数据分析、选取样本,还能帮助我们发现异常值和异常数据,以及在基于比较的任务中进行归一化处理。

二、zscore模型怎么验证

在对数据进行zscore标准化之前,我们需要考虑数据的分布情况,以确保zscore的准确性和可靠性。

我们可以通过正态性检验来验证数据是否符合正态分布。若数据呈正态分布,则zscore的效果更好。

from scipy.stats import shapiro

_, p_value = shapiro(data)
if p_value > 0.05:
    print('数据符合正态分布,可以使用zscore标准化!')
else:
    print('注意:数据不符合正态分布,需进行其他处理或者转换!')

三、zscore模型计算公式

zscore计算公式如下:

z = (x – μ) / σ

其中x代表当前样本值,μ代表数据集的均值,σ代表数据集的标准差。

四、zscore值对应表

zscore值对应表可以用来判断数据点所处的位置,如下表所示:

zscore值     说明
>= 3         异常值
[-3, 3]      正常值
<= -3        异常值

五、zscore模型

zscore模型是一种用于归一化数据的方法,它可以将数据标准化为符合标准正态分布的形式,使得不同维度的数据具有可比性。

在实际应用中,zscore模型常被用于数据挖掘、机器学习、数据预处理等领域。

六、zscore标准化

zscore标准化可以将原始数据值转化为标准正态分布的形式,使得不同维度的数据可以进行比较和分析。

下面是基于Python实现的zscore标准化代码:

def zscore_normalize(data):
    mu = np.mean(data)
    sigma = np.std(data)
    normalized_data = []
    for x in data:
        normalized_data.append((x - mu) / sigma)
    return normalized_data

七、zscore是什么意思

zscore是用来衡量一个数据点相对于均值的相对位置的指标。它是将原始数据转化为标准正态分布的形式后,计算当前数据点和均值之间的距离,并以标准差为单位来表示的。

八、zscore模型公式

zscore模型公式如下:

z = (x – μ) / σ

其中x代表当前样本值,μ代表数据集的均值,σ代表数据集的标准差。

九、zscore公式

zscore是用于计算数据点相对于均值的距离的指标,计算公式为:

z = (x – μ) / σ

其中x代表当前样本值,μ代表数据集的均值,σ代表数据集的标准差。

以上是对zscore模型的详细阐述,zscore在数据分析、机器学习、数据预处理等领域有着广泛的应用,希望本文可以对您有所帮助。

原创文章,作者:CQOT,如若转载,请注明出处:https://www.506064.com/n/143700.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
CQOTCQOT
上一篇 2024-10-22 23:35
下一篇 2024-10-22 23:35

相关推荐

  • TensorFlow Serving Java:实现开发全功能的模型服务

    TensorFlow Serving Java是作为TensorFlow Serving的Java API,可以轻松地将基于TensorFlow模型的服务集成到Java应用程序中。…

    编程 2025-04-29
  • Python训练模型后如何投入应用

    Python已成为机器学习和深度学习领域中热门的编程语言之一,在训练完模型后如何将其投入应用中,是一个重要问题。本文将从多个方面为大家详细阐述。 一、模型持久化 在应用中使用训练好…

    编程 2025-04-29
  • Python zscore函数全面解析

    本文将介绍什么是zscore函数,它在数据分析中的作用以及如何使用Python实现zscore函数,为读者提供全面的指导。 一、zscore函数的概念 zscore函数是一种用于标…

    编程 2025-04-29
  • Python实现一元线性回归模型

    本文将从多个方面详细阐述Python实现一元线性回归模型的代码。如果你对线性回归模型有一些了解,对Python语言也有所掌握,那么本文将对你有所帮助。在开始介绍具体代码前,让我们先…

    编程 2025-04-29
  • ARIMA模型Python应用用法介绍

    ARIMA(自回归移动平均模型)是一种时序分析常用的模型,广泛应用于股票、经济等领域。本文将从多个方面详细阐述ARIMA模型的Python实现方式。 一、ARIMA模型是什么? A…

    编程 2025-04-29
  • VAR模型是用来干嘛

    VAR(向量自回归)模型是一种经济学中的统计模型,用于分析并预测多个变量之间的关系。 一、多变量时间序列分析 VAR模型可以对多个变量的时间序列数据进行分析和建模,通过对变量之间的…

    编程 2025-04-28
  • 如何使用Weka下载模型?

    本文主要介绍如何使用Weka工具下载保存本地机器学习模型。 一、在Weka Explorer中下载模型 在Weka Explorer中选择需要的分类器(Classifier),使用…

    编程 2025-04-28
  • Python实现BP神经网络预测模型

    BP神经网络在许多领域都有着广泛的应用,如数据挖掘、预测分析等等。而Python的科学计算库和机器学习库也提供了很多的方法来实现BP神经网络的构建和使用,本篇文章将详细介绍在Pyt…

    编程 2025-04-28
  • Python AUC:模型性能评估的重要指标

    Python AUC是一种用于评估建立机器学习模型性能的重要指标。通过计算ROC曲线下的面积,AUC可以很好地衡量模型对正负样本的区分能力,从而指导模型的调参和选择。 一、AUC的…

    编程 2025-04-28
  • 量化交易模型的设计与实现

    本文将从多个方面对量化交易模型进行详细阐述,并给出对应的代码示例。 一、量化交易模型的概念 量化交易模型是一种通过数学和统计学方法对市场进行分析和预测的手段,可以帮助交易者进行决策…

    编程 2025-04-27

发表回复

登录后才能评论